WebDuring telophase, chromosomes arrive at opposite poles and unwind into thin strands of DNA, the spindle fibers disappear, and the nuclear membrane reappears. Cytokinesis is the actual splitting of the cell membrane; animal cells pinch apart, while plant cells form a cell plate that becomes the new cell wall. WebSpindle Fibers Function. Spindle fibres help in the division of genetic component of the cell during division. Spindle fibres are formed during both mitosis and meiosis cell division. …
WebNov 18, 2024 · Spindle fibers are formed from microtubules with many accessory proteins which help guide the process of genetic division.
